They got my interest with the prepaid services by saying that you only need to pay .99c + TAX Per SIM CARD and just pay month to month basis, and here come the lies, they say that this cards work with any type of iphones that i will going to get excellent 4g speed unlimited. When the SIM card arrived I activated adding certain amount, and to my surprise have not service, i call them and they said i need to unlock my phone,
i unlocked my phone but then i was not able to send pictures and on top of that i only got the basic speed on internet, in other words useless internet it takes forever to open just one page and it keeps freezing all the time. Now i called them back, and now they told me that t-mobile is not compatible with iphones and sometimes it work and sometimes it doesnt and unfortunately they wont reimburse any money put on this plan, and they are sorry but there is nothing they can do, oh yes that probably they will add more towers at the end of next year.

Tmobile runs on different frequencies than most iPhones have built in to them. For the mms you need to set up the carrier apns to get this to work. All that is possible when you unlock a phone to use on t-mobile is edge internet. Nothing else.
It is not a rip off, becuase all t-mobile is required to let you do is talk,text, and data connection. You have talk, you have text, and you have a data connection. Not their fault you chose a phone that is incompatible with the network that you chose to go to.
